The Isdera Commendatore 112i was a one-off concept car that was introduced in 1993. The Commendatore 112i was built in a streamlined and stylish coupe body style similar to many supercars of the era. The intention was to create another limited production run of supercars, but due to financial issues, only the concept was built. This singular car was powered by a Mercedes-Benz M120 6.0L V12 engine that had 402hp, which it sent to the rear wheels through a 6 speed manual transmission.
